Curaçao v Ivory Coast — Group Stage - 3, FIFA World Cup 2026 — final score Curaçao 0–2 Ivory Coast
Curaçao v Ivory Coast was played at Lincoln Financial Field, Philadelphia, in Group Stage - 3 of the FIFA World Cup 2026. Final score: Curaçao 0, Ivory Coast 2. Here is how the eight inocta-bench analysts called the match before kickoff, and who got it right.
The eight analysts' predictions
- Solo (The Soloist) predicted Ivory Coast at 68% confidence, score 0–2 — correct (Brier 0.159). Reasoning: Ivory Coast has a clear quality gap with a 150-point ELO edge and market implying around 70 percent. Curacao shipped seven goals to Germany and lacks attacking depth beyond Locadia. Ivory Coast's midfield with Kessie and Sangare plus Diallo on the wing should break down a deep block. Curacao must chase the game to advance, opening transition lanes Ivory Coast exploits well. A controlled 2-0 fits the talent disparity and Ivory Coast's pragmatic approach needing only a draw to advance.
- Solo-Zero (The Purist) predicted Ivory Coast at 74% confidence, score 0–2 — correct (Brier 0.105). Reasoning: Ivory Coast are reigning AFCON champions with a deep pool of top European-based talent. Curacao, while improving and historically punching above their weight via diaspora players, lack the same quality and depth. On a neutral US venue both sides travel, but Ivory Coast's individual quality in attack and midfield should be decisive. Expect a controlled win rather than a blowout given Curacao's organization.
- Pipeline (The Assembly Line) predicted Ivory Coast at 62% confidence, score 0–2 — correct (Brier 0.224). Reasoning: Ivory Coast are clearly the stronger side by ELO and squad depth, and Curaçao must abandon their deep block chasing a win, which plays directly into Ivory Coast's transition game in hot Philadelphia conditions. Curaçao concede heavily in the 31-45 and 76-90 windows, matching Ivory Coast's late-scoring profile. Market 81% feels rich given two doubtful CIV centre-backs and stakes asymmetry letting CIV game-manage, so I settle near 62%. A controlled 2-0 fits the expected goal environment and CIV's risk profile.
- Pipeline-Static (The Creature of Habit) predicted Ivory Coast at 74% confidence, score 0–2 — correct (Brier 0.105). Reasoning: Ivory Coast has a 150-point ELO edge and the market prices them near 81 percent. Curaçao must chase the game to survive in the group, which pulls them out of the deep block that is their only viable structure. Without Locadia their transition threat thins, and the Philadelphia heat punishes the older squad. Ivory Coast can control tempo and exploit Curaçao's 31-45 and 76-90 concession windows. 0-2 is the modal score with 0-1 the main alternative.
- Council (The Council) predicted Ivory Coast at 68% confidence, score 0–2 — correct (Brier 0.159). Reasoning: All three council members unanimously pick Ivory Coast 2-0, reflecting a clear talent and depth advantage over World Cup debutants Curacao. Curacao must chase the game to advance, which opens space for Ivory Coast's transition threats like Diallo and Kessie. Curacao's 7-1 loss to Germany exposed defensive frailties when forced to open up. Confidence sits at 68 given the unanimous direction but accounting for tournament variance, possible Ivorian complacency if a draw suffices, and goalkeeper Room's proven ability to keep things tight.
- ELO (The Statistician) predicted Ivory Coast at 59% confidence, score 1–1 — correct (Brier 0.261). Reasoning: ELO ratings: Curaçao 1569, Ivory Coast 1719. Neutral venue, no home adjustment. Implied: home 18%, draw 24%, away 59%. Computed from 59 internationals since June 2022. K=30 World Cup, K=20 others, goal-difference weighted. No AI involved.
- Market (The Market) predicted Ivory Coast at 81% confidence, score 1–1 — correct (Brier 0.056). Reasoning: Closing line via Pinnacle, de-vigged proportionally. Implied: home 6.5%, draw 12.5%, away 81.0%.
- Mo (The Human) predicted Ivory Coast at 75% confidence, score 0–2 — correct (Brier 0.097). Reasoning: Ivory Coast has too much power and quality for Curaçao.
